When choosing archery hunting equipment, don’t attempt to shoot using hunting gear that’s heavier than you can deal with. Ensure that your bow and arrows are the right size for you to achieve precision.
Two materials you might consider for arrows are aluminium and carbon. Carbon arrows are more rigid, meaning the animal will be pierced more deeply. These arrows don’t come cheap, though. Aluminium arrows provide a high-quality alternative that will last. You’ll find that even though aluminium arrows can bend they do cost less than carbon arrows.
When selecting a broad head, you can go with an expandable blade or a fixed blade. An expandable head will shoot straight, but will not wound as deeply as fixed blades can. Any fixed blade could go clean through a target.
Of course, there are various types of archery bows: longbows, compound bows, recurve bows, crossbows, plus others. Choose the bow that’s comfortable for you to use. Crossbows are for experienced hunters and should not be the choice of beginners or youngsters as they are very powerful and intended for long-range use. There are also specific bows children can use. Should you choose to use practice bows, try longbow and recurve bows.
Although the bows and arrows are the central pieces of bow hunting gear, you will also need accessories: targets for training, armrests for a more even shot and gloves for shooting ease.
